Advancements in Deep Learning for Edge Detection

The integration of deep learning techniques has revolutionized the field of edge detection. Researchers have been exploring the use of convolutional neural networks (CNNs) to improve the accuracy and efficiency of edge detection algorithms. One of the latest trends is the development of CNN-based architectures that can learn to detect edges in images with varying levels of noise and complexity. These advancements have significant implications for applications such as object recognition, segmentation, and tracking. For instance, in the field of healthcare, deep learning-based edge detection can be used to analyze medical images and detect abnormalities, such as tumors or fractures.

Mathematical Morphology: A New Frontier in Image Analysis

Mathematical morphology has emerged as a powerful tool for image analysis, offering a unique perspective on the spatial structure of images. This approach focuses on the use of morphological operators to extract relevant features from images, enabling the detection of edges, lines, and other geometric structures. Recent innovations in mathematical morphology have led to the development of new algorithms and techniques, such as the use of fuzzy morphology and morphological profiles. These advancements have far-reaching implications for applications such as image filtering, segmentation, and classification. For example, in the field of security, mathematical morphology can be used to analyze surveillance images and detect suspicious activity.

Future Developments: Quantum Computing and Edge Detection

As we look to the future, it's exciting to consider the potential impact of quantum computing on edge detection. Quantum computing has the potential to revolutionize the field of image processing, enabling the analysis of complex images at unprecedented speeds. Researchers are currently exploring the use of quantum algorithms for edge detection, which could lead to significant breakthroughs in applications such as real-time object recognition and tracking. While still in its infancy, the integration of quantum computing and edge detection has the potential to transform the field of image processing, enabling new applications and use cases that were previously unimaginable.
